I didn’t do separate bodyweight exercises this week but I’ve been doing drills during my morning skates that involve holding deep lunges + squats while skating (my leg muscles are always BURNING afterwards) so I feel like sidney crosby would still be proud of me. running in the cooler weather today was good because it reminded me that I am actually a bit stronger physically than it feels when I run in the heat. I also just want to remind myself that since April I’ve gone from finding it taxing to run for a minute and a half to being able to run for twenty minutes without stopping. that’s pretty encouraging progress! AND I’ve gone from having to work pretty hard to get 30 min of skating in to really enjoying my fairly intense 90 min morning skate workouts.
I know I’ve said this before but I think the most pleasant surprise this past month has been really feeling the habit lock in. this is week 13 or about three months from when I decided I really wanted to ramp up my activity levels, with the goal of eventually getting to 45 min of moderate to vigorous intensity exercise every day. this week I averaged 94 min/day (or maybe a little lower since some of my short evening walks were pretty leisurely).
here’s what I am noticing:
it now feels instinctive to get out of bed and work out for an hour or more first thing in the morning. the trick seems to be choosing a morning workout that I enjoy and look forward to (rollerblading!) and also pairing it with a fun podcast so that the experience is as positively self-reinforcing as possible. but even on days like today (too wet outside to skate), I still found it easy to get up and go for a run. the habit feels solid now—like it’s just part of my daily routine.
I just feel better when I work out in the morning. my mind is sharper, my body feels less sluggish, and I’m better able to ride out the waves of quarantine anxiety and the lowgrade “this year suuuucks” feelings throughout the day. I don’t even want to know what I would be feeling like if I wasn’t keeping active. I am positive that I would be SIGNIFICANTLY more wild-eyed and depressed if I wasn’t getting out of the house and spending 1-2 hours in the sun every day.
being outside is.. life-changing. WOW!!! I could see myself rejoining my gym when this is all over just so I can have lap pool access, but I think a positive part of all of this is that I’ve discovered how fun it is to move around outside. I feel like I resisted exercise for a long time for many reasons, but one of them is definitely the fact that I find gym machines to be extremely tedious + group exercise classes to be socially stressful. I also like having control over how far I go and how hard I work, which I think maps onto a lot of the teaching research I’ve done about intrinsic motivation and the importance of giving students meaningful autonomy and choice in learning environments. I tend to work harder and enjoy the experience so much more when I feel like I am making the choices and deciding what I want to tackle each day.
on the subject of intrinsic motivation: I have also discovered that I feel way more motivated to work out when I have a clear sense of purpose. I have always loathed the way that mainstream fitness/diet culture teaches women to think about exercise, where the emphasis is on ‘perfecting’ your body and then on scrupulously maintaining the small gains you make, or like, diligently working to try to cancel out the fact that you have to occasionally eat food to stay alive. and of course the goal of all that constant fussy maintenance is to turn your body into something that men will find sexually desirable. bleh!! I feel like getting quite into watching sports and learning a lot about athletes’ daily routines this year has introduced me to a radically different way of thinking about exercise. I am not going to become a pro athlete anytime soon lol but I love the idea that exercise can be this really purposeful thing, where you are doing various kinds of exercises to gradually strengthen your body and build up your body’s capacity to perform different kinds of physical tasks. I think a lot of the principles of good teaching apply here too: exercise as a form of teaching/learning, where your body is learning how to do progressively more challenging things, and as you master one set of tasks or sharpen one set of skills, you introduce a new challenge that takes you a little further out of your comfort zone and makes you push yourself a little bit harder.
I also REALLY like that I can tangibly see or feel the real world applications of what my body is ‘learning.’ like the more time I spend working on my lunges/squats and balancing exercises off my skates, the more I feel my endurance increasing and the more power I’m able to harness when taking off from a stop into a dead sprint. it’s just very cool to feel like my mind + body are wholly engaged in this type of physical learning, and it’s also amazing to think about ‘progress’ in terms of increasing my physical strength and confidence and ability to complete challenging tasks, instead of in terms of like... becoming more ~desirable or conforming more closely to our culture’s dumb standards of waifish beauty. feels really good!!!! and it ends up making me feel way better about my body, not because of what my body looks like but because I’m like, super proud of the things we’re learning how to do together. what an amazing way to feel!

Okay so like 10-ish years ago, I had gotten bedbugs, and it SUUUUCKED. We think that I got them from the student lounge at school, since at the same time I realized I had them the couches in the lounge were replaced with something non-fabric. Anyway, as some of you probably already know, it’s a whooooole ordeal when you get bedbugs. You don’t just have to strip your bed and clear out everything around the bed itself and possibly get a new mattress, which is hard enough; you also have to clear everything out from against the walls, too. The way exterminators treat bedbugs is they have to spray EXTREMELY toxic chemicals in the bed, around the bed, and along all the corners where the floor meets the wall, because bedbugs nest and reproduce in crevices.
Most of you guys have seen pictures of my room, SO YOU CAN IMAGINE how difficult it was to clear out space along my walls. I have ENORMOUS shelves that are FULL of books and collectibles, and we ended up having to get a storage unit for a short while because I basically had to pack up my entire room and move it temporarily. This process even damaged a very rare and expensive Sonic statue I have, which makes me weep to this day. After the extermination was done, and after it was deemed safe to go in my room again (because like I said, SUPER TOXIC), I then completely covered my mattress and baseboard with trash bags that I sealed with duct tape, and then put a special bedbug cover over the mattress as well. The reason for this is that I wasn’t able to get a new mattress at the time, which would’ve been the first recommendation, so instead I had to seal off the current one as much as possible. Even as toxic as the sprays are, bedbugs are OUTRAGEOUSLY hard to kill and sometimes still live through it, and they can survive without food and water for like a year, so if any of them survived the process they needed to essentially be entombed.
